If utilizing a wood-burning camping tent oven, be sure to utilize only dry, tidy fire wood. Damp wood creates even more smoke and increases levels of carbon monoxide and co2 in your tent. Furthermore, stay clear of burning Christmas trees and any products consisting of tinted paint (these can produce harmful gases).
Make sure to put on heat-resistant gloves when handling your oven and ash-laden gas logs. Additionally, be careful when packing up at the end of your trip to make certain that your cooktop has actually cooled down before you try to dismantle and load it. This will help stop any kind of unintended burns from the hot stove parts. Additionally, be sure to use a campfire mat underneath your oven to shield the flooring from heat and cinders.

Security
While tent cooktops give unequaled warmth, convenient food preparation surfaces, and undeniable setting, they likewise come with some safety and security issues. Like all fire sources, they posture the danger of carbon monoxide poisoning otherwise utilized correctly. To minimize the threat, appropriate stove positioning, chimney arrangement, and a trustworthy fire extinguisher are vital.
When building the first fire, start with small kindling and progressively add bigger logs until the fire is sustained. This will prevent flare-ups and overheating. Throughout use, clean the chimney occasionally to stop blocking and to permit air flow. Damp wood generates even more smoke and less warm, while seasoned or completely dry wood burns extra effectively.
Positioning an oven mat under the oven will certainly protect your outdoor tents floor from warm coal and triggers, while permitting you to move around the fire easily. Also, constantly keep combustibles (such as insect repellent and hairspray) at least a couple of feet away from the cooktop to prevent unintended fires.
